Trump's "healthy" fight, White House publishes health results:
Donald Trump

US President Donald Trump, who turns 80 on June 14, underwent a full medical checkup last week at Walter Reed National Military Center in Bethesda, Maryland.

Unlike in previous years, the White House did not immediately release a detailed report on the president's health. Initially, Trump himself made do with a post on his Truth Social network, where he declared that the results of the examinations were "perfect."

The full report was later released by the president's physician, Sean Barbabella, according to which Trump's cardiac, pulmonary and neurological functions are in good condition, while his overall physical condition is assessed as positive.

Trump's health has been the subject of much discussion in recent months, as he became the oldest president to take office in U.S. history. His lifestyle, especially his eating habits, has also drawn much attention, although Trump does not drink alcohol.

However, Dr. Barbabella's report seems to dismiss concerns about his physical and mental state. According to the doctor, Trump has a "cardiac age" about 14 years younger than his biological age, while on the Montreal Cognitive Assessment test, which is used to assess cognitive functions, he received the maximum score of 30 points out of 30 possible.

The only concern highlighted in the report is related to the president's weight. Compared to the last check-up conducted in April of last year, Trump has gained 6.3 kilograms and now weighs 108 kilograms.

Although his height of 1.90 meters partially mitigates this factor, the doctor recommends more careful monitoring of his weight and cholesterol levels.

For this reason, Barbabella has suggested to the president a more careful eating regimen and regular physical activity.
